SM City Baliwag Welcomes New Dining Experiences


SM City Baliwag is expanding its culinary scene with the addition of two exciting new restaurants: Mr. Mala Hotpot and Sumo Niku. These additions promise a diverse range of flavors and dining experiences for Bulakenyos.

Sumo Niku: Unleash Your Inner Samgyup Enthusiast 

For those seeking a thrilling food adventure, Sumo Niku offers an unlimited Japanese barbecue experience. Located on the ground level of SM City Baliwag, this new restaurant is the perfect destination for a fun and satisfying meal with friends and family.

Sumo Niku's all-you-can-eat deal features a delectable spread of premium grilled meats, including pork, beef, and chicken, all cooked to perfection. The experience is enhanced by a variety of side dishes, special sauces, and endless drinks for just P599 per person[1] .

Mr. Mala Hotpot: A DIY Hotpot Adventure

Perfect for both chilly evenings and warmer days, Mr. Mala Hotpot invites diners to embark on a personalized hotpot journey. This restaurant also sits on the ground level of SM City Baliwag and allows guests to create their own unique hotpot experience in six easy steps:

1. Grab a bowl

2. Pick ingredients

3. Weigh the bowl

4. Choose broth

5. Select spice level

6. Add condiments[1]

With its customizable options, Mr. Mala Hotpot caters to diverse tastes and preferences, ensuring a satisfying and flavorful experience for every diner.
